WebThe MRC breathlessness scale is widely used to describe. obtained in a few seconds. patient cohorts and stratify them for interventions such as. pulmonary rehabilitation in COPD [6]. It can predict. survival [7] and it is advocated as complementary to. Validity FEV1 in describing disability in those with COPD [8].
